Road cycling routes around Decize are characterized by a landscape of rivers, canals, and gently rolling countryside. The region is situated at the confluence of the Loire and Aron rivers, with numerous bridges and waterways defining the terrain. Elevation changes are generally moderate, with some routes featuring gradual climbs and descents. The area includes parts of the La réserve naturelle régionale Loire Bourguignonne, offering routes through natural reserves and along riverbanks.

The parents of the Mother of God MARY, whose birth this church celebrates as its patron, are the two saints Anne and Joachim. Thus, they are the grandparents of Jesus, but they are not mentioned by name in the biblical writings of the New Testament. An exact date in the historical-scientific sense is not known for the various stages in the life of the Mother of God. But the feast of the birth of the God-bearer – as one of the numerous honorary titles of Mary is – is celebrated on September 8th in many Christian denominations (Catholic, Anglican, Orthodox, and Armenian).

A "treidelpfad" (towpath) that runs alongside the river or canal's bed was an essential part of the transport infrastructure in earlier times. Before ships could be powered by motors, horses walked along the bank, pulling the boat against the current. This was called "treideln" (towing), and this is how the towpaths got their name, which has been passed down to this day. Where these paths, located directly along the bank, have been preserved, they are popular with hikers and cyclists.

There are over 30 road cycling routes around Decize, offering a diverse range of experiences for cyclists. These routes are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.4 stars.
The road cycling routes in Decize are predominantly easy to moderate. You'll find 8 easy routes, 20 moderate routes, and 3 more challenging options. The region is characterized by gently rolling countryside and moderate elevation changes, making it accessible for various skill levels.
Yes, Decize offers 8 easy road cycling routes perfect for beginners or families. These routes often follow waterways and canal paths, providing a gentle and scenic ride. An excellent option is the Riviéres & canaux — loop in the La réserve naturelle régionale Loire Bourguignonne, which is 27.6 miles (44.4 km) and features minimal elevation.
Absolutely. For those seeking a longer ride, Decize has several routes that extend for considerable distances. The Circuit des Ponts — loop in the La réserve naturelle régionale Loire Bourguignonne is a moderate 58.0 miles (93.4 km) path, while the Loire Bridge – Nevers loop from Decize covers 48.9 miles (78.6 km) through the Loire River valley.
Many of the road cycling routes around Decize are designed as loops, allowing you to start and finish in the same location. Examples include the popular Riviéres & canaux — loop in the La réserve naturelle régionale Loire Bourguignonne and the Circuit des Ponts — loop in the La réserve naturelle régionale Loire Bourguignonne.
Road cycling in Decize offers picturesque views of rivers, canals, and the gently rolling countryside. You'll encounter numerous bridges and waterways, as the region is at the confluence of the Loire and Aron rivers. Routes often pass through parts of the La réserve naturelle régionale Loire Bourguignonne. Notable attractions include the town of Decize itself and the historic Nivernais Canal.
Given Decize's location at the confluence of two rivers and its gently rolling terrain, many routes offer scenic viewpoints, particularly along the Loire River. Look for spots like the Picnic area on the banks of the Loire River, which provides a great place to rest and enjoy the views.
The best time for road cycling in Decize is typically during the spring, summer, and early autumn months when the weather is mild and the natural scenery is at its most vibrant. The region's moderate climate makes it enjoyable for cycling for a significant portion of the year.
While specific cafes are not listed for every route, the routes often pass through or near small towns and villages where you can find local establishments for refreshments. The town of Decize itself offers various amenities, and routes along canals or rivers often have picnic areas or small stops.
The komoot community highly rates road cycling in Decize, with an average score of 4.4 stars from over 10 reviews. Cyclists often praise the region's tranquil waterways, the well-maintained canal paths, and the charming, gently rolling countryside that makes for enjoyable and accessible rides.
Yes, the Nivernais Canal is a prominent feature in the Decize area, and several routes incorporate its scenic banks. The Decize – Banks of the Nivernais Canal loop from Decize is a moderate 50.4 km (31.3 miles) route that allows you to experience this historic waterway.
